KABUL, Afghanistan

The U.S. Forces Afghanistan (USFOR-A) has begun its conditions-based reduction of forces in Afghanistan, an official said.

In a statement on Monday, the USFOR-A spokesman Col. Sonny Leggett said the reduction of troops is in line with the U.S.-Afghanistan joint declaration and the U.S.-Taliban agreement.

Late last month, the U.S. and Taliban inked a landmark peace deal laying out a timetable for a full troop withdrawal from Afghanistan.
